Summary
CVE-2023-52191 is a vulnerability that affects the Torbjon Infogram – Add charts, maps and infographics plugin versions up to 1.6.1. It is classified as an '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ation' or 'Cross-site Scripting' vulnerability. This vulnerability allows for stored XSS attacks. The risk score for this vulnerability is 25, with a base severity of medium and a base score of 5.4 according to NIST. The exploitability score is 2.3, requiring low privileges and user interaction over a network attack vector. The impact of this vulnerability is low on integrity and confidentiality, with no availability impact. Remediation measures are not specified in the provided information.
